      But the early Christian fathers knew that pagan beliefs and rituals and images which had become part of the lives of cultures and communities over thousands of years could not be eliminated overnight by edict. Some have survived even to this day: Easter eggs, maypoles, May Queens, Yule logs, Christmas trees, holly and mistletoe ...

      Even today the maypole dance remains popular in Europe and the U.S., particularly among tightly-knit subcultures or ethnic groups: it is a link to ancient fertility rituals for pagan and Wiccan groups, and a way to celebrate Celtic, Germanic, or Nordic heritage for ethnic communities in the U.S. (Beattie, 2006).
